Transaction 03a5f75c7ebae18023771e9027cb8d560c126e7128f77dcbf4977892bd3d0da4

1 Input
2 Outputs
  • 03a5f75c7ebae18023771e9027cb8d560c126e7128f77dcbf4977892bd3d0da4:0
  • value  17927700
    address  1Chq9Pigu8P4UzRKnyCZaCCTzj76MBvCMP
  • 03a5f75c7ebae18023771e9027cb8d560c126e7128f77dcbf4977892bd3d0da4:1
  • value  170201954
    address  18pGGZtZ9r55YEMRqZB9JK3zDaibp1hUkM